- [ ] Step 7: Archive cold storage buckets (Glacierline tier). Confirm both ceremony witnesses are present, verify bucket manifests match the Oxbow ledger, then seal the archive key shares. Plugin authors may observe but not handle shares. Once sealed, the archive index itself is encrypted and can only be reopened with the passphrase below.

vault phrase of badup-hahig = tamael-aldael-kelmir-istael-fenok-istwyn-tamius-jorath-oliion

Meeting notes — Passkey Huddle, Tuesday

Quick recap for support: the revamped password reset flow on Glimmerport ships next sprint. Reset links now expire in 15 minutes instead of 24 hours, and users get a confirmation banner. Expect a bump in "my link expired" tickets the first week. If anything looks broken, escalate straight to the flow's owner, named below.

named custodian: Belius Casath Ulaix Sorius

Action item from the Fennick outage review: our connection pool exhausted under moderate load because the pool ceiling, idle timeout, and acquisition deadline were left at library defaults, which assume far fewer workers than we run. This change right-sizes the pool per service tier and adds a leak detector. Reviewer, please sanity-check the arithmetic against our worker counts. The proposed pool constants are below.

tuning table, yajog-yahof:
BUDGETS = {
    "lamvan": 303,
    "wenox": 460,
    "fenvan": 525,
}

Before each Penderock gateway release, verify the rate-limit config under /etc/penderock/limits.yaml matches the values approved in the capacity review. The token-bucket defaults are 200 req/s per internal client, with burst 400; do not raise these without sign-off from the platform group. After applying the config, restart the Mallow sidecar and confirm 429 counts return to baseline within ten minutes. The final config bundle must be signed before distribution to the fleet, using the deploy key below.

signing key of bagap-yawep = bky13_TbfT6ZMUoGJo2